#cce4e9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cce4e9 is composed of 80% red, 89.4%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.4% cyan, 2.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 190.3 degrees, a saturation of 39.7% and a lightness of 85.7%. #cce4e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#99c9d3.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#cce4e9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cce4e9 has RGB values of R:204, G:228, B:233 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 13427945.

Hex triplet cce4e9 #cce4e9
RGB Decimal 204, 228, 233 rgb(204,228,233)
RGB Percent 80, 89.4, 91.4 rgb(80%,89.4%,91.4%)
CMYK 12, 2, 0, 9
HSL 190.3°, 39.7, 85.7 hsl(190.3,39.7%,85.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 190.3°, 12.4, 91.4
Web Safe ccccff #ccccff
CIE-LAB 89.02, -6.91, -5.129
XYZ 67.35, 74.206, 87.861
xyY 0.294, 0.323, 74.206
CIE-LCH 89.02, 8.606, 216.589
CIE-LUV 89.02, -13.052, -6.759
Hunter-Lab 86.143, -11.192, -0.172
Binary 11001100, 11100100, 11101001

Shades and Tints of #cce4e9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020304 is the darkest color, while #f5faf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#cce4e9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dadbdb is the less saturated color, while #b8f1fd is the most saturated one.
